Jovago partners with eCEX 2015
Jovago, Africa’s largest hotel booking portal, makes landmark
contributions at the first e-commerce exhibition and seminar, organised by the
Ideas Hub in Lagos over the weekend.
The programme tagged ‘eCEX’ which brought together the
disruptive thinkers across the information technology and trade sector had
participants explore the nation’s internet opportunities as well as chart a
course to tap into the burgeoning growth expected.
Speaking at the panel discussion, Omolara Adagunodo, Head
for Customer Service, Jovago Nigeria said, “Customer Service is the pivot on
which a successful business runs. No matter what you are doing, excellent (not
just good) service will always distinguish you and that is what we offer at
Jovago.”
In line with supporting the industry, exhibitions and product
showcases were presented by merchants committed to offering quality e-services
to a wide range of clients.
Further highlighting Jovago’s commitment to developing of
the hospitality industry, Marek Zmyslowski, its Managing Director said, “We
will transform the hospitality industry in Nigeria. At the moment, we offer
seamless online hotel bookings anywhere you travel in the world, with a focus
on the African market, where we have built the biggest inventory of verified
hotels you can choose from. This is to
ensure you get best possible customer service, combining worldwide experience
with local know-how.”
At present, the company provides booking services to 7000
hotels within Nigeria. Its recent expansion to Ghana and Senegal are expected
to double its output by the last quarter of the year.
The second edition of the eCEX is expected to hold in the
third quarter of 2016.
